Study On Each Prescription Compatibility Reduce Cinnabar-caused Nephrotoxicity In Wanshi Niuhuang Qingxin Pills

ObjectiveTo confirm on each prescription in Wanshi Niuhuang Qingxin Pills reduce nephrotoxicity in rats that caused by cinnabar,And provide reference for further study on the substance basis of compatibility attenuation of Wanshi Niuhuang Qingxin pills.MethodsA total of 168 healthy SD rats(180±20g),female and male were half and half,were randomly divided into 7 groups Rats were given by gavage cinnabar+each prescription(cinnabar+coptis,cinnabar+scutellaria,cinnabar+gardenia,cinnabar+turmeric,cinnabar+bezoar),establishment of cinnabar group and the whole recipe at the same time,containing 1.0g/kg cinnabar at all of the groups,once a day for 12 weeks.During the administration,the situation in rats such as behavior,appearance,body weight change,diet,secretion,excretion,etc,were observed.The rats were weighed twice a week,the dosage according to body weight adjustment.24 h urine were collected after repeated dosing 4,8,12 weeks and drug withdrawal for 4 weeks.The blood and kidney of 6 animals(3male and 3 female)in each group were collected under general anesthesia.The mercury contents in the blood,the kidney and the urine were determined by Zeeman atomic absorption mercury analyzer.The concentrations of blood uric acid and serum creatinine were measured by automatic biochemical analyzer.The content of hydroxyproline in renal tissue was tested by sample alkaline hydrolysis test kit.Kidney tissue slices were made,and pathological changes were observed under light microscope by HE staining and Masson staining.m RNA expression of TNF-? and IL-10 was tested by Real-time PCR.The data were represented by average and standard deviation,and were analyzed by SPSS17.0 statistical software.The difference among the groups was analyzed by single factor analysis of variance(One-Way ANOVA),and the the difference between two groups was analyzed with S-N-K or Dunnett's T3.The level of significance test was 0.05.ResultsDuring the study,the general conditions of rats were normal and their body weight was steadily grown,there was no significant difference between different groups.After repeated dosing 4,8,12 weeks and drug withdrawal for 4 weeks,The content of blood mercury of cinnabar and coptis,scutellaria,gardenia or turmeric compatibility group were lower than that of the single cinnabar group(P<0.05),blood mercury of each prescription group were higher than the whole recipe group(P<0.05).The content of kidney mercury in cinnabar and Coptis,gardenia or turmeric compatibility were lower than cinnabar group(P<0.05),each prescription were higher than the whole recipe,The content of urine mercury in cinnabar and Coptis or turmeric compatibility were lower than cinnabar group(P < 0.05),cinnabar and scutellaria,gardenia,turmeric or bezoar compatibility were higher than the whole recipe.After repeated dosing8,12 weeks and discontinuous drugs for 4 weeks,the content of BUA in cinnabar and scutellaria,gardenia,turmeric or bezoar compatibility were lower than cinnabar group(P < 0.05),the content of SCr in cinnabar and coptis,scutellaria,gardenia,turmeric or bezoar compatibility were lower than cinnabar group(P<0.05).Kidney was dark red(Chinese herbal pigment)in the whole recipe,cinnabar and gardenia compatibility,with the extension of time,thedeeper the color,a slight improvement after discontinuous drugs for 4 weeks.Under the light microscopy,the kidney tissue of cinnabar group rats was renal tubular epithelial cell vacuolar degeneration,swelling,bureaucratic narrow,part of the tubular structure disappeared,the gap widened,lumen protein tube,interstitial infiltration of inflammatory cells(lymphocytes and mononuclear cells),mild interstitial fibrous hyperplasia lesions,mainly at the junction of renal cortex pulp.The pathological lesions in the whole recipe,each prescription lighter than cinnabar group,there were pigment deposition in the whole recipe,cinnabar and gardenia compatibility.After repeated dosing 12 weeks,the expression of TNF-? and IL-10 in the whole recipe were lower than cinnabar group(P<0.05),the TNF-? expression of male rats in cinnabar and Coptis,turmeric compatibility were lower than cinnabar group(P<0.05),the TNF-? expression of female rats in cinnabar and scutellaria compatibility were lower than cinnabar group(P<0.05).ConclusionsWanshi Niuhuang Qingxin Pills reduce cinnabar-caused nephrotoxicity in rats.Cinnabar and coptis,gardenia or turmeric compatibility can antagonistic mercury absorption caused by cinnabar or promotes urinary mercury excretion;reduce the accumulation of mercury in renal tissue.Wanshi Niuhuang Qingxin Pills and each prescription can reduce the renal pathological changes caused by cinnabar.Wanshi Niuhuang Qingxin Pills antagonistic nephrotoxicity in rats that caused by cinnabar is more obvious than cinnabar and each prescription compatibility.
